Our client is the world leader in research and advisory services to tech corporations internationally. Established for over 40 years, they employee more than 10,000 people across the globe and turn over $billions every year.
Because of their continued growth they are seeking an experienced Talent Sourcer to join them on an initial 6 month contract, with the potential to move into a permanent position within the organisation.
Reporting to the Recruiting Team Lead, the Internal Talent Sourcer will be responsible for sourcing high quality candidates across EMEA. Duties include:
- Source potential and passive candidates through direct channels, social media, internet sourcing, extensive name generation research and relationship building
- Continually expand network through leveraging user groups, blogs and networking events
- Generate candidate interest through creative marketing and social media messaging by clearly articulating the Gartner value proposition
- Prequalify potential candidates to determine their qualifications through profiling, trait assessments and behavioural based interviewing
- Develop a pipeline of talent for current role and future hiring needs
This is a very fast paced role, requiring the following skills and experience:
- Bachelor's degree and 1-3 years Recruiting or Talent Acquisition experience required
- Strong research and candidate generation skills
- Business Development and/or Sales experience a plus
- Familiarity with current direct sourcing techniques and ability to remain current with developing new techniques and skills
- Confidence when dealing with executive level candidates
Please note although this role is remote, they may require travel to the Surrey offices at least once a month.
